A luggage carrier that is easy to use and more importantly, easy to store. The internal frame collapses to make the carrier just 3" deep, allowing for storage just about anywhere. The framework also keeps the carrier's shape open making for easy loading and unloading, while the three openings (both sides and rear) allow access from almost any side of the vehicle.

Rola Pursuit Fold-Away Luggage Carrier


Features:
  • Rainproof construction
  • Lightweight corrosion resistant aluminum frame
  • Internal construction maintains carrier's aerodynamic shape
  • Easily folds flat when not in use to reduce wind drag and promote fuel efficiency
  • Rainproof cover keeps carrier clean

Specs:
  • 13-1/2" cubic feet of storage space
  • Size when in use: 57" x 33" x 17"
  • Folded size: 57" x 33" x 3"
  • Mounts to most factory installed and aftermarket roof racks
  • Will fit on cross bars that measure between 23" and 32" apart from front to back
  • U-bolts that connect bag to roof rack measure 3-1/4" apart
  • Cross bars cannot be wider than 3-1/4"(U-bolts will not fit if bars are wider)

  • Are the Yakima GetOut and Rola Pursuit Cargo Bags Waterproof
  • Rooftop cargo bags like the Rola Pursuit Collapsible Cargo Bag, # 59150, and the Yakima GetOut Rooftop Cargo Bag, # Y07187, are designed to be water resistant, but not waterproof. To be waterproof, a bag must be able to be submerged in water without allowing any water to enter the bag. The zippers on the bag do not have the ability to prevent water from entering when submerged. Weather resistant, however, means the bags will keep the contents dry under normal rain or snow condition, but some
